<p><span style="background-color:#ffffff;"><a href="http://tempexport1.files.wordpress.com/2009/08/3113e-6a00d83456074b69e20120a578093c970c-320wi.png" style="float:right;"><img alt="Picture 11" class="at-xid-6a00d83456074b69e20120a578093c970c " src="{{ site.baseurl }}/assets/2009/08/3113e-6a00d83456074b69e20120a578093c970c-320wi.png" style="margin:0 0 5px 5px;" /></a> Prophet is a lightweight schemaless database designed for peer to peer replication and disconnected operation. Prophet keeps a full copy of your data and (history) on your laptop, desktop or server. Prophet syncs when you want it to, so you can use Prophet-backed applications whether or not you have network.</span></p>
<p><span style="background-color:#ffffff;">SD (Simple Defects) is a peer-to-peer issue tracking system built on top of Prophet. In addition to being a full-fledged distributed bug tracker, SD can also bidirectionally sync with your RT, Hiveminder, Trac, GitHub or Google Code issue tracker.&#160;</span></p>
